This patch lets you create mulitpart/alternative message parts in the
compose screen.
Here is a usage description by the author:
The <group-alternatives> binding for the componse menu (where
you press
's' to send) combines selected attachments into a multipart/alternative
group. The <move-up> and <move-down> bindings then allow you to change
their order.

This patch allows regular expression based transformation of email
subjects when displayed in the index. It can be useful to get rid of
mailing list tags (e.g. [list-name]), or trim long subject lines.
